Output acf8e9fc942542940d243894443618cc6a6d55eaac31f3035e30871a4c6205a9:4

value
171562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c5fb047ad18baaf4b40cb5b72ddb1b86566783 OP_EQUAL
address
3KB2A7TpyBNtmjFDfiQ4vo2bgYKxC5Lgb2
transaction
acf8e9fc942542940d243894443618cc6a6d55eaac31f3035e30871a4c6205a9
confirmations
494078
spent
true